Departmental Overview

UC Berkeley Youth Recreation (formerly Cal Youth Camps) offers a wide variety of seasonal camps, swimming, and sport activities for kids of all ages. We have been leaders in providing high quality, impactful youth programs for more than 60 years.

Position Summary

UC Berkeley Youth Recreation offers several experiential leadership opportunities for junior high- and high school-aged youth in our summer youth camps. Our experiential leadership programs bridge junior and high schoolers from campers to leaders. The best Youth Camps staff are often former campers. Youth Camp alumni not only bring their own experience and memories, but they also bring an undeniable passion for camp. UC Berkeley Youth Recreation offers several different ways for tweens and teens to practice and improve their varying leadership skills.

The Junior Counselor position is a paid staff position for high school students to learn the beginning requirements of youth supervision, professional conduct, effective communication, and teamwork responsibility. The Junior Counselor role also assists in enhancing leadership and job skills skills required for this UC Berkeley program and future careers.

Responsibilities

PROGRAMMATIC

  • Adhere to all scheduling assignments made by Camp Coordinator(s), Camp Lead(s) and Asst. Lead(s) to support campers, camper groupings, and activities.
  • Support and assist activity Instructor(s) and / or assigned Group Leader(s) with any delegated tasks.
  • Provide mentoring and guidance to campers in support of camp staff.
  • Lead general supervision of campers and downtime activities during the camper lunch period.
  • Assist with the set-up and take-down of camp facilities and help tidy camp areas on a daily basis.
  • Account for all campers in assigned group and conduct camper head counts regularly.
  • Follow check-in / out duties as assigned.
  • Walk campers safely between locations and supervise them on water / restroom breaks as needed.
  • Assist campers with their belongings, lost and found, sunscreen / water, lunch, swim change, trash pick-up, etc.
  • Assist with and / or participate in all special events, staff meetings, theme days, and programs designated by your leadership team and / or supervisor.
  • Look for ways to improve the camp / program and share feedback in weekly staff meetings with the leadership team or designated team leader.

ADMINISTRATIVE

  • Prepare, maintain, and process all forms and paperwork accurately and promptly (work permits, reports, timesheets, employee paperwork, etc.).
  • Complete Accident Reports, Incident Reports, and Child Abuse / Neglect (CANRA) forms when needed, making sure to alert supervisors.
  • Follow campus-wide procedures in Mandated Reporting laws regarding child abuse and neglect (CANRA).
  • Refer program and administrative questions to the appropriate supervisor.
  • Keep equipment and supplies in order, well maintained, and in the proper location.

    Mandated Reporter

    This position has been identified as a Mandated Reporter required to report the observed or suspected abuse or neglect of children, dependent adults, or elders to designated law enforcement or social service agencies. We reserve the right to make employment contingent upon completion of signed statements acknowledging the responsibilities of a Mandated Reporter.

    Misconduct

    SB 791 and AB 810 Misconduct Disclosure Requirement : As a condition of employment, the final candidate who accepts a conditional offer of employment will be required to disclose if they have been subject to any final administrative or judicial decisions within the last seven years determining that they committed any misconduct; received notice of any allegations or are currently the subject of any administrative or disciplinary proceedings involving misconduct; have left a position after receiving notice of allegations or while under investigation in an administrative or disciplinary proceeding involving misconduct; or have filed an appeal of a finding of misconduct with a previous employer.

    Misconduct means any violation of the policies or laws governing conduct at the applicant's previous place of employment, including, but not limited to, violations of policies or laws prohibiting sexual harassment, sexual assault, or other forms of harassment, discrimination, dishonesty, or unethical conduct, as defined by the employer.
